A joint stock company enjoys perpetual existence because
There is a higher degree of specialization
It is a corporate entity
It is formed by a minimum of seven members
Its shares are easily
Correct answer is B
A joint stock company enjoys perpetual existence because it is a corporate entity. This means that the company is a legal person separate from its members. As a result, the company can continue to exist even if the members change or die.
